[奥鹏]大工22春《Java程序设计》在线作业2[答案]

作者:奥鹏作业答案 字体:[增加 减小] 来源:大工在线 时间:2022-05-26 10:22

大工22春《Java程序设计》在线作业2 试卷总分:100 得分:100 一、单选题 (共 10 道试题,共 50 分) 1.Java使用()关键字来定义一个接口。 A.implements B.class C.extends D.interface 2.final关键字不能修饰的参数是

[奥鹏]大工22春《Java程序设计》在线作业2[答案]

大工22春《Java程序设计在线作业2[答案]

正确答案:B

大工22春《Java程序设计在线作业2 试卷总分:100 得分:100 一、单选题 (共 10 道试题,共 50 分) 1.Java使用()关键字来定义一个接口。 A.implements B.class C.extends D.interface 2.final关键字不能修饰的参数是()。 A.类 B.成员 C.变量 D.方法 3.在编写异常处理

正确答案:C

大工22春《Java程序设计》在线作业2

试卷总分:100  得分:100

一、单选题 (共 10 道试题,共 50 分)

1.Java使用()关键字来定义一个接口。

A.implements

B.class

C.extends

正确答案:A

D.interface

正确答案:B

 

2.final关键字不能修饰的参数是()。

A.类

B.成员

C.变量

D.方法

正确答案:B

 

3.在编写异常处理的Java程序中,每个catch语句块都应该与()语句块对应,使得用该语句块来启动Java的异常处理机制。

A.if-else

B.switch

C.try

D.throw

正确答案:D

 

4.属于main方法的返回值类型是()。

A.public

B.static

C.void

D.main

正确答案:D

 

5.下面概念中,不属于面向对象方法的是()。

A.对象

B.继承

C.类

D.过程调用

正确答案:C

 

6.接口中方法默认是()类型。

A.private

B.protected

C.public

正确答案:C

D.package

正确答案:B

 

7.将源文件转化为机器指令的方式是()。

A.编译方式

B.解译方式

C.解码方式

D.编辑方式

正确答案:C

 

8.在Java中,由Java编译器自动导入,而无需在程序中用import导入的包是()。

A.java.applet

B.java.awt

C.java.util

D.java.lang

正确答案:C

 

9.下面不是Java语言特点的是()。

A.动态性

B.面向对象

C.编辑型

D.多线程

正确答案:D

 

10.不是Java关键字的是()。

A.class

B.byte

C.goto

D.import

正确答案:D

 

大工22春《Java程序设计》在线作业2[答案]多选题答案

正确答案:C

二、判断题 (共 10 道试题,共 50 分)

11.super()和this()调用语句可以同时在一个构造函数中出现。

 

12.在Java语言中属性前不加任何访问控制修饰符则表示只允许同一包中的类访问。

 

13.接口中的方法均为抽象的和公共的,既有方法头,也有方法体。

 

14.this语句须是构造函数中的第一个可执行语句。

 

15.Java源程序是由类定义组成的,每个程序可以定义若干个类,但只有一个类是主类。

 

16.final修饰的方法一定要存在于final类中。

 

17.构造函数与类名同名,没有返回值类型,功能用来初始化一个类的具体对象。

 

21.Java中类和接口都只能单继承。

 

19.在Java语言中声明数组时,无论用何种方式定义数组,都要指定其长度。

 

20.String类对象创建之后可以再修改和变动。

 

 

------分隔线----------------------------

大工22春《Java程序设计》在线作业2[答案]历年参考题目如下:

,需要答案请联系dddda98


Java程序设计21春在线作业2题目

试卷总分:100  得分:100

一、单选题 (共 10 道试题,共 30 分)

1.以下哪项可能包含菜单条()

A.Panel

B.Frame

C.Applet

D.Dialog

 

2.哪个关键字可以对对象加互斥锁? ( )

A.transient

B.synchronized

C.serialize

D.static

 

3.为了使包ch4在当前程序中可见,可以使用的语句是().

A.import ch4.*;

B.package ch4.*;

C.ch4 imporl,;

D.ch4 package

 

4.下列程序的输出结果是 import java.io.*; public class abc { public static void main(String args[]) { String s1="Hello!"; String s2=new String("World!"); System.out.println(s1.concat(s2)); } }

A.false

B.Hello!

C.Hello!Wofld!

D.12

 

5.下列说法错误的是()

A.接口是多继承的具体实现形式。

B.3305L是长整型数。

C.03916是八进制数。

D.?:是三目条件运算符

 

6.若有定义 int a=1,b=2; 则表达式(a++)+(++b) 的值是()

A.3

B.4

C.5

D.6

 

7.Java语言的类型是()

A.面向对象语言

B.面向过程语言

C.汇编程序

D.形式语言

 

8.线程开始运行时,是从下列哪一个方法开始执行的( )

A.main()

B.start()

C.run()

D.init()

 

9.以下程序的输出结果是() public class koo{ public static void main(String args[]) { int x=1,sum=0; while(x<=10) { sum+=x; x++; } System.out.println("sum="+sum); } }

A.45

B.55

C.10

D.11

 

10.main()方法的返回类型是:()

A.int

B.void

C.boolean

D.static

 

二、多选题 (共 10 道试题,共 30 分)

11.下面哪些是合法的标识符?()

A.$persons

B.TwoUsers

C.*point

D.this

 

12.import javawt.*; publiclass X extends Frame{ publistativoimain(String[] args){   X x=new X();   x.pack();   x.setVisible(true);   } publiX(){ setLayout(new BorderLayout()); Panel p=new Panel(); add(p,BorderLayout.NORTH); Button b=new Butto

A.标有"North"和"South"的两个按钮具有相同的宽度

B.标有"North"和"South"的两个按钮具有相同的高度。

C.标有"North"的按钮的高度可以随窗口的大小而改变。

D.标有"North"的按钮的宽度不随窗口的大小而改变。

 

13.在Java中,下列关于final关键字的说法正确的有()。

A.如果修饰变量,则一旦赋了值,就等同一个常量

B.如果修饰类,则该类只能被一个子类继承

C.如果修饰方法,则该方法不能在子类中被覆盖

D.如果修饰方法,则该方法所在的类不能被继承

 

14.下面关于类的封装的描述,哪两个是正确的?()

A.成员变量没有访问控制符。

B.成员变量可以直接访问。

C.成员变量的访问控制符是private

D.提供方法对数据进行访问和修改

 

15.下面关于继承的叙述正确的有 ()。

A.在java中只允许单一继承

B.在java中一个类只能实现一个接口

C.在java中一个类不能同时继承一个类和实现一个接口

D.java的单一继承使代码更可靠

 

16.以下AWT类中哪些实现部件的布局?()

A.FlowLayout

B.GridBagLayout

C.ActionListener

D.WindowAdapter

 

17.publiclass X implements Runnable{ publistativoimain(String[] args){ 3) //在这插入代码   }   publivoirun(){   int x=0,y=0; for(;;){ x++; Y++; System.out.println("x="+x+",y="+y);   }   } } 下面哪些代码加在第3行可以使run()运行?

A.X x=new X();   x.run();

B.X x=new X();   new Thread(x).run();

C.X x=new X();   new Thread(x).start();

D.Threat=new Thread(x).run();

 

18.下列哪个方法属于播放声音的方法?()

A.loop()

B.stop()

C.start()

D.play()

 

19.指出下列哪个方法与方法public void add(int a){}为合理的重载方法。()

A.public int add(int a)

B.public void add(long a)

C.public void add(int a,int b)

D.public void add(float a)

 

20.以下哪些不是MenuItem类的方法?()

A.setVisible( boolean b )

B.setEnabled( boolean b )

C.getSize()

D.setForeground( Color c )

 

三、判断题 (共 20 道试题,共 40 分)

21.break语句可以用在switch语句、while循环、do……while循环和for循环结构中。

 

22.圆弧可以看作是椭圆的一部分。绘制圆弧的方法为drawArc。

 

23.接口是由常量和抽象方法组成的特殊类。

 

24.接口是特殊的类,所以接口也可以继承,子接口将继承父接口的所有常量和抽象方法。

 

25.图形绘制是由java.awt.Graphics类实现的,通常在面板JPanel进行绘制。

 

26.一个类只能有一个父类,但一个接口可以有一个以上的父接口。

 

27.类String对象和类StringBuffer对象都是字符串变量,建立后都可以修改。

 

28.子类要调用父类的方法,必须使用super关键字。

 

29.在Java语言中,drawOval(100,100,80,80)表示绘制圆,其中(100,100)表示圆心。

 

30.每个 try 块都必须至少有一个 catch 块与之相对应。

 

31.TCP/IP方案中有三个最常用的协议,分别是IP、TCP和UDP。

 

32.在线程程序中,临界资源,或临界区是指在物理空间中临近的资源。

 

33.各种类型数据混合运算中,不同类型的数据先转化为同一类型,然后进行运算。

 

34.Java包中包含了URL类和URLConnection类,这些类具有强大的功能。

 

35.Java中,并非每个事件类都只对应一个事件。

 

36.Java中的String类的对象既可以是字符串常量,也可以是字符串变量。

 

37.在父类中声明为 final 的方法,也可以在其子类中被重新定义(覆盖)。

 

38.整型一般都以十进制的形式表示,也可以写成八进制或十六进制。

 

39.Java中数组的元素只可以是简单数据类型。




[奥鹏]大工22春《Java程序设计》在线作业2[答案]相关练习题:
记账人员在登记账簿时,应当遵守的最基本规则是( )。

下列叙述,正确的是

电子仓库是PDM的核心

元代戏曲包括了杂剧和散曲。

物物交换有其自身的局限性,只要表现在时间和的需求的巧合,另一个表现在____

程序设计说明书由()

根据《合伙企业法》的规定,下列哪些事项须由全体合伙人同意才能做出决议()

调查效度的含义是()。

财务管理是企业组织财务活动,处理与各方面()的一项经济管理工作。

( )是指能反映出社会发展、社会效果、社会影响在某些方面的利弊得失的指标。

在比较法中,提高估价精度的一个基本保证,是收集的交易实例的内容信息要( )

下列哪些选项属于消费者的购买动机()

反应难溶性固体药物吸收的体外指标是:( )

ISO9000系列标准的指定机构为( )

按对利率的管制程度的不同,利率可以分为

父母与多对已婚子女组成的家庭是( )

“刚脏” 指的是

气液两相共存时( )

招标公告不是要约邀请

在大电感负载三相全控桥中,当α=90°时,整流电路的输出是( )。

作业咨询:
点击这里给我发消息

论文咨询:
点击这里给我发消息

合作加盟:
点击这里给我发消息

服务时间:
8:30-24:00(工作日)